## NAME
       csum - checksum update action

## SYNOPSIS
       **tc **... **action csum _**UPDATE_

       _UPDATE_ := _TARGET_ [ _UPDATE_ ]

       _TARGET_ := { **ip4h **| **icmp **| **igmp **| **tcp **| **udp **| **udplite **| **sctp **| _SWEETS_ }

       _SWEETS_ := { **and **| **or **| **+ **}

## DESCRIPTION
       The  **csum  **action triggers checksum recalculation of specified packet headers. It is commonly
       used to fix incorrect checksums after the **pedit **action has modified the packet content.

## OPTIONS
       _TARGET_ Specify which headers to update: IPv4 header (**ip4h**), ICMP header (**icmp**),  IGMP  header
              (**igmp**),  TCP  header  (**tcp**), UDP header (**udp**), UDPLite header (**udplite**) or SCTP header
              (**sctp**).

       **SWEETS **These are merely syntactic sugar and ignored internally.

## EXAMPLES
       The following performs stateless NAT for incoming packets from 192.0.2.100 to new destination
       198.51.100.1. Assuming these are UDP packets, both IP and UDP checksums have to  be  recalcu‐
       lated:

              # tc qdisc add dev eth0 ingress handle ffff:
              # tc filter add dev eth0 prio 1 protocol ip parent ffff: \
                   u32 match ip src 192.0.2.100/32 flowid :1 \
                   action pedit munge ip dst set 198.51.100.1 pipe \
                   csum ip and udp
